I have a 2006 QX56 and love it. We were gonna buy the lexus GX and switched in the day we bought. Plenty of space and power. I have no complaints with the purchase. Comparing the two same years we got ours with less mileage more options cleaner in and out and lower cost. Carmax - 30day policy they have to correct/replace/repair anything that you are unhappy with. We had some wear on the steering controls, a hairline crack in the center counsel, lumbar air bag wouldnt inflate, and a plastic fender cover was loose. They replaced all that and i almost got free tires too. They'll replace them free if they are worn enough. Im 2nd owner.

If i ever buy used i'll always check their lots first.
